Serotonin's Cousins: Exploring the Diverse Effects of Tryptamines
Tryptamines, a extensive family of compounds, have captivated the scientific community for their intriguing effects on the human brain and body. Sharing a common structural element with serotonin, these molecules bind to similar receptors, producing a array of physiological and psychological outcomes. From the well-known mood-altering properties of LSD to the neuroprotective potential of certain tryptamines, this fascinating class of compounds offers a glimpse into the complex interplay between chemistry and consciousness.
